Ingredients for Creamy Pesto and Chicken Salad with Apples and Pecans
- 3 cups cooked shredded Chicken
- 1/2 cup Mayonnaise
- 4 Tablespoons store-bought or homemade Pesto (or to taste)
- 2 Celery stalks, diced
- 1/2 cup Pecans, whole or chopped
- 1 bunch of seedless Grapes
- 1-2 sweet Apples, chopped
- Freshly squeezed juice from half a Lemon (or to taste)
- Salt and Pepper, to taste
Instructions for Creamy Pesto and Chicken Salad with Apples and Pecans
- Place shredded chicken in a large bowl. Add the mayo, pesto, celery, pecans, apples and grapes. Mix everything.
- Taste and season with salt and pepper, as needed. Refrigerate for several hours to allow flavors to blend. Just before serving, squeeze some lemon juice to give it that fresh tang! Enjoy!
